Basic Function

The Manager – Environmental – APAC has three primary roles:

1. Expert Support & Leadership

  • Provide environmental leadership and strategy to all APAC businesses, consistent with Huntsman’s corporate standards and procedures.
  • Ensure compliance with legislative and corporate requirements.
  • Drive continuous performance improvement by identifying and developing improvement opportunities.
  • Identify and reduce environmental risks.
  • Lead communication and stakeholder engagement.

2. Environmental Data & Metrics

  • Review reported environmental data and provide input on environmental metrics and projects supporting Huntsman’s EHS targets and sustainability program.

3. Strategic Support

  • Advise APAC businesses on soil and groundwater assessments.
  • Analyze data for trends, incorrect reporting, and unlikely patterns.
  • Support environmental remediation, M&A due diligence, EHS auditing, and related activities.

The incumbent collaborates with the Corporate EHS Legal group for timely EHS-related disclosures and participates in the Corporate Legacy and Remediation Network. Additionally, the incumbent serves as a regional leader for environmental excellence, mentoring site-based EHS managers and strengthening environmental capability across APAC.

Statistics / Dimensions

The incumbent is responsible and accountable for:

  • Ensuring the timeliness and accuracy of publicly disclosed EHS (APAC region) information.
  • Conducting due diligence for acquisition, divestment, and merger deals (potentially $100 million to $1 billion).
  • Providing strategic and expert environmental consultancy for all Huntsman Corporation divisions globally.
  • Ensuring compliance with Huntsman standards and local regulatory requirements.
  • Sharing best practices, reporting metrics, and identifying areas for continuous improvement.

Relationships

  • Reports directly to the Global Environmental Senior Manager, with a strong functional link to the APAC Regional EHS Director.
  • Responsible for selecting and managing external environmental service providers (consultants and contractors) for technical studies and regulatory requirements.
  • Works closely with global EHS personnel, Corporate EHS Governance and Shared Services, Division Leadership, and the EHS Global Leadership Group.
  • Attends leadership meetings (e.g., Global EHS Leadership Group, APAC Regional EHS Leadership Team, Legacy/Remediation Network) as needed.
  • Maintains a wide network of internal and external contacts, including subject matter experts, regulators, consultants, suppliers, and business contacts.

Know-How

  • Minimum: Bachelor’s degree in EHS, environmental science, engineering, or chemistry (strong data/statistical analysis skills required).
  • Preferred: Master’s or postgraduate qualifications in related fields.
  • At least 15 years of relevant experience in EHS, operations management, engineering, or project management.
  • Strong working knowledge of environmental regulations (especially in China and APAC), operational practices, and greenhouse gas accounting.
  • Exceptional interpersonal and influencing skills, with experience working with senior management.

Problem Solving

  • Ability to identify, analyze, and define problems; develop and recommend solutions.
  • Implement solutions within authority or gain approval by working with all organizational levels.
  • Requires adaptive thinking—analytical, interpretative, evaluative, and constructive.
  • Operates within general company policies but often needs innovative solutions for unique circumstances.
  • Strategic objectives set by the Global Environmental Senior Manager; tactical objectives by the APAC Regional EHS Director.
  • Must handle ambiguity to determine specific activities and programs to achieve objectives.

Accountability

  • Protect the company’s financial well-being by identifying and communicating potential EHS risks, liabilities, and sustainability issues for all APAC operations.
  • Responsible for due diligence in mergers, acquisitions, divestitures, third-party claims, and emerging regulatory initiatives.
  • Ensure the timeliness and accuracy of publicly disclosed EHS and sustainability information.
  • Shared responsibility for EHS compliance and supporting line management.
  • Implement transformational change in environmental matters within APAC, in line with Huntsman’s direction.
  • Foster a culture of innovation and excellence in environmental management.
  • Provide expert advice on environmental matters as a member of the Global Environmental Team.
  • Manage consultants/contractors for soil and groundwater monitoring/remediation, or support site resources in these activities.

Organization Chart

  • Direct reporting line to the Global Environmental Senior Manager.
  • Dotted-line relationship with the APAC Regional EHS structure.
